Post by nintendologic on Jun 6, 2020 13:54:41 GMT -5
I suppose I should chime in even though there's no real need given that top 100 is running away with this poll. I know I'm the one who suggested a top 50 ballot, but I have no strong preference either way. I think the only real differences between a list drawn from top 50 ballots and one drawn from top 100 ballots would be at the margins. Looking at last year's results, every match in the top 100 was in at least one voter's top 50 and all but eight were in at least one voter's top 25. My concern was people putting in substantially more work for negligible reward. But if people find putting together a top 100 ballot (and looking at other people's ballots) rewarding in ways besides meaningfully impacting the final results, that's fine by me.
